What’s the avodah of Yom Ha’atzmaut? Beyond the flags and barbecues, Rav Shlomo Katz opens Tehillim 107—“Hodu laHashem ki tov, ki le’olam chasdo”—to uncover the inner work of the day: cultivating awareness of the miracles we’re living through right now.

Drawing parallels between Yetziat Mitzrayim and the modern return to Eretz Yisrael, Rav Shlomo explains that just as we retell the Exodus every year, we must also learn, teach, and feel the miracle of 1948 and everything that’s unfolded since. This isn’t only about gratitude. It’s about recognition.

With heartfelt stories, laughter, and prayer, he invites us to step into Tehillim’s words—“ומארצות קבצם ממזרח וממערב מצפון ומים”—and realize: David HaMelech was writing about us.
